Laser Imaging and Modeling

The project is designed to adopt laser imaging in combination with software developed on the DragonBoard™ 410c from Arrow Electronics to scan any designated object and get its pseudo-3D model. The laser imaging unit is composed of line laser and camera. The specific structure calibrated by software can be used for high precision modeling of the object. The DragonBoard 410c software was developed on QT and uses Open CV for image processing. The acquired pseudo-3D model can be viewed in MeshLab.

Pseudo-3D modeling and similar techniques are used to simulate the appearance of a scene or an image being three-dimensional (3D) in films, television shows, and video games.

Project Details

  • Creator: Michael Liu
  • Project Name: Laser Imaging and Modeling
  • Type of Project: Demo
  • Project Category: Computer Vision, Gaming
  • Board(s) used: 96Boards Consumer Edition

Resources

RSS URL

View project on Qualcomm Developer Network

Build / Assembly Instructions

  • Fix the optical filter in front of the lens of camera and guarantee no light leak.
  • Fix the camera on the guide rail of horizontal head.
  • Fix the laser head on the movable table of horizontal head such that it can move horizontally.
  • After the hardware setup is complete, install the software.

Usage Instructions

  • Place an object in the camera bellows and the guide rail in front of the bellows.
  • Install the software and open it. Set the darkness of camber bellows and click to start scanning.
  • Slowly move the movable table of head and laser-scanned blue lines will appear on screen. When the blue lines seem sufficiently dense, click to stop scanning and the 3D file will be generated.